Description

A new current measurement module, SoM-CAM, is being deployed to replace CAMAC-based systems that have been in operation for more than 30 years in most of HIPA instrumentation electronics. Multiple tests have been performed to assess the readiness and reliability of the new module, with particular emphasis on safety-critical applications such as beam loss monitors. The enhanced capabilities of SoM-CAM enable detailed recording and analysis of the time structure of beam losses associated with interlock events. The paper presents the validation results and outlines the planned timeline for the complete replacement of CAMAC systems.
